●● Why Pure Cultures Are Important:
Answer: Used to study bacterial metabolism and morphology without
contamination from other microbes.


●● Growth Medium:
Answer: Nutrient material used to grow bacteria; must be sterilized
before inoculation.


●● Aseptic Technique:
Answer: Procedures used to prevent contamination of people, materials,
the environment, and cultures.


●● Streak Plating:
Answer: Method used to isolate bacteria by dragging cells across an agar
plate to dilute them.


●● Well-Isolated Colonies:
Answer: Colonies separated enough to likely contain cells from only one
bacterium type.

,●● Mixed Culture:
Answer: Culture containing more than one species of microorganism.


●● Colony Morphology:
Answer: The visible characteristics of bacterial colonies such as shape,
size, color, and texture.


●● Spread Plating:
Answer: Method where diluted bacteria are spread evenly across agar to
isolate or count cells.


●● Serial Dilution:
Answer: Stepwise dilution process used to reduce bacterial
concentration gradually.


●● Confluent Growth (Lawn):
Answer: Continuous bacterial growth covering the entire agar surface.


●● Direct Microscopic Count:
Answer: Counting cells directly under a microscope using a counting
chamber.

, ●● Advantage of Direct Microscopic Counts:
Answer: Rapid way to estimate cell numbers.


●● Disadvantage of Direct Microscopic Counts:
Answer: Cannot distinguish living cells from dead cells.


●● Counting by Spread Plating:
Answer: Method of estimating viable bacteria by counting colonies
formed on agar plates.


●● Valid Colony Count Range:
Answer: Plates with 30-300 colonies are considered accurate for
counting.


●● Concentration:
Answer: Amount of particles or cells per unit volume.


●● Concentration Formula:
Answer: C = P / V (concentration = particles ÷ volume).


●● Dilution:
Answer: Reduction in concentration by adding diluent.
